What is Hogan's waggle?
The Ben Hogan Golf Waggle Explained A waggle is the preparatory move prior to striking the golf ball. So as you set the club down behind the golf ball what Hogan did was pick the club up, move it towards the target, and then waggle it back behind him like this.
What is the point of a golf waggle?
— The waggle keeps your body in motion before the swing — this sets the table for some decent rhythm and timing. And while we are on the subject, the waggle can be used to set the tempo and cadence of the upcoming swing.
